{"data":{"id":"us/12-cfr-141.10","jurisdiction":"us","citation":"12 CFR 141.10","heading":"Dwelling unit.","body":"The term dwelling unit means the unified combination of rooms designed for residential use by one family, other than a single-family dwelling.","path":["Title 12—Banks and Banking","CHAPTER I—COMPTROLLER OF THE CURRENCY, DEPARTMENT OF THE TREASURY","PART 141—DEFINITIONS FOR REGULATIONS AFFECTING FEDERAL SAVINGS ASSOCIATIONS"],"source_url":"https://www.ecfr.gov/api/versioner/v1/full/2026-08-25/title-12.xml","current_through":"2026-08-25","vintage":"","retrieved_at":"2026-08-27T02:24:16Z","sha256":"c5d63fde7f475d555af115fd9487127c61542542a96aebd6e3f23b32875b2fd9","source_id":"us-cfr","stale":true,"prev":"us/12-cfr-141.8","next":"us/12-cfr-141.11"},"notice":"GroundRules: Original legal text.
